This is a Première – for Antje Weithaas. Her first orchestral recording with two of the “big” solo concertos. And obviously also the realization of one of her top dreams and wishes; the combination of her two favourite concertos. At the time of the recording (2012) Steven Sloane was still Music Director of the Stavanger Sympfoniorkester. Yet another recording of the Beethoven Violin Concerto? Haven’t enough exemplary recordings been made already, in overwhelming quantity? Antje Weithaas laughs: “I know. But I have dealt with this piece so intensely over the years that I believe to have found a self-sufficient version. With this piece, which I love so much, I feel a certain inner assurance.” Weithaas still remembers the very moment when, as a schoolchild, she nonchalantly placed her parents’ worn-out score of the Beethoven Concerto on the music stand with the intention of sight-reading it. Later on, at university level, she seriously mastered the work, and it has remained her constant companion ever since.
